THE JOBThe US Concerts Technology team seeks a highly motivated, passionate, and enthusiastic individual to provide on‑site IT support at Live Nation events and venues across the country. As a Venue IT Support Representative at the Xfinity Center, you’ll gain real‑world experience and an intimate understanding of IT service delivery concepts.
What This Role Will Do- Provide onsite IT troubleshooting assistance to venue administrative, operations, and production staff.
- Identify, track, and resolve persistent issues; report problems to remote support or service delivery teams following established escalation procedures.
- Act as an onsite liaison with remote IT support teams to troubleshoot reported issues.
- Serve as the onsite contact and provide guided access for visiting IT service or support providers.
- Assist tour production by establishing artist Internet connectivity and fulfilling artist/tour IT riders prior to and on “day of show.”
- Provide proactive day‑of‑show IT event support by ensuring no outstanding hardware/software issues with point‑of‑sale or access control technologies before gates open.
- Assist with deployment, inventory management, and maintenance of onsite IT equipment, including POS terminals.
- Develop and leverage a comprehensive understanding of venue network connectivity and deployed technologies.
- Lead resolution of all F&B‑related IT issues, collaborating with other stakeholders to determine fixes.
- Participate in seasonal IT preparation, validation, shutdown, and winterization.
- Assist in extending existing venue IT infrastructure or implementing new infrastructure to support special events such as festivals or private events.
